Title<br />

prefix comm<strong>and</strong>s — <strong>Quick</strong> reference for prefix comm<strong>and</strong>s<br />

Description<br />

Prefix comm<strong>and</strong>s operate on other <strong>Stata</strong> comm<strong>and</strong>s. They modify the input, modify the output,<br />

<strong>and</strong> repeat execution of the other <strong>Stata</strong> comm<strong>and</strong>.<br />

Com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>Reference</strong> Description<br />

by [D] by run comm<strong>and</strong> on subsets of data<br />

statsby [D] statsby same as by, but collect statistics from each run<br />

rolling [TS] rolling run comm<strong>and</strong> on moving subsets <strong>and</strong> collect statistics<br />

bootstrap [R] bootstrap run comm<strong>and</strong> on bootstrap samples<br />

jackknife [R] jackknife run comm<strong>and</strong> on jackknife subsets of data<br />

permute [R] permute run comm<strong>and</strong> on r<strong>and</strong>om permutations<br />

simulate [R] simulate run comm<strong>and</strong> on manufactured data<br />

svy [SVY] svy run com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> adjust results for survey sampling<br />

mi estimate [MI] mi estimate run comm<strong>and</strong> on multiply imputed data <strong>and</strong> adjust results<br />

for multiple imputation (MI)<br />

nestreg [R] nestreg run comm<strong>and</strong> with accumulated blocks of regressors, <strong>and</strong><br />

report nested model comparison tests<br />

stepwise [R] stepwise run comm<strong>and</strong> with stepwise variable inclusion/exclusion<br />

xi [R] xi run comm<strong>and</strong> after exp<strong>and</strong>ing factor variables <strong>and</strong><br />

interactions; for most comm<strong>and</strong>s, using factor variables<br />

is preferred to using xi (see [U] 11.4.3 Factor variables)<br />

fracpoly [R] fracpoly run comm<strong>and</strong> with fractional polynomials of one regressor<br />

mfp [R] mfp run comm<strong>and</strong> with multiple fractional polynomial regressors<br />

capture [P] capture run com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> capture its return code<br />

noisily [P] quietly run com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> show the output<br />

quietly [P] quietly run comm<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> suppress the output<br />

version [P] version run comm<strong>and</strong> under specified version<br />

The last group—capture, noisily, quietly, <strong>and</strong> version—have to do with programming<br />

<strong>Stata</strong>, <strong>and</strong> for historical reasons, capture, noisily, <strong>and</strong> quietly allow you to omit the colon.<br />
